Paternoster Farm: Coastal Dining in Pembroke
Savor fresh Pembrokeshire seafood and seasonal Welsh fare in a charming farm setting near Pembroke’s stunning coast.
Paternoster Farm is a renowned restaurant located on the B4320 near Pembroke, Wales, celebrated for its fresh, locally sourced seafood, especially catches from Pembrokeshire day-boats. Set in a rural coastal area, it offers a rustic yet refined dining experience with a focus on seasonal ingredients and Welsh culinary traditions. The farm setting enhances its charm, making it a favored spot for food lovers seeking authentic Pembrokeshire flavors.

A Taste of Pembrokeshire’s Coastal Bounty
Paternoster Farm sits in the picturesque Pembrokeshire countryside, where the rich marine environment provides a continual supply of fresh seafood. The restaurant’s menu highlights the day’s catch from local fishing boats, ensuring that diners enjoy the freshest flavors of the sea. While Paternoster Farm has been a beloved local institution, recent developments indicate that the restaurant is scheduled to close due to lease non-renewal by Pembrokeshire County Council.
